Test batsman Sir Everton Weekes, who died on July 1, played for Bacup in Lancashire between 1949 and 1958. Along with Frank Worrell and Clyde Walcott, he formed what became known as 'The Three Ws' of the West Indies cricket team. His homesickness for Barbados was tempered by his landlady's potato pies and the presence of Worrell and Walcott, who were playing for League clubs Radcliffe and Enfieldrespectively. The Local Democracy Reporting Service said he was devastating in the Lancashire leagues, scoring 25 centuries and passing 1,000 runs in each season. Everton Weekes : biography 26 February 1925 – Sir Everton DeCourcy Weekes, KCMG, GCM, OBE (born 26 February 1925) is a leading former West Indian cricketer. Weekes's performances were a significant contribution to League crowds, with over 325,000 spectators attending Lancashire League matches in 1949, a record as yet unsurpassed. Walcott was a member of the "three W's", the other two being Everton Weekes and Frank Worrell: all were very successful batsmen from Barbados, born within a short distance of each other in Bridgetown, Barbados in a period of 18 months from August 1924 to January 1926; all made their Test cricket debut against England in 1948. In 1949 Weekes accepted an offer of £500 to play as the professional for Bacup in the Lancashire League. Weekes scored an extraordinary 9,069 runs for Bacup at 91.61, with 25 centuries, including 195* against Enfield, a score that remains a League record as does his 1954 batting average of 158.25.
